# Dolly Parton

The "Dolly Parton" pinball machine, released by Bally in November 1979, features a design by George Christian and artwork by Dave Christensen. With a production run of 7,350 units, this machine is themed around the iconic country singer Dolly Parton. The game includes two flippers, three pop bumpers, five stand-up targets, and an inline drop target bank. Players aim to spell "DOLLY" and "PARTON" for bonuses.
